#166C6C Hex Color Code

#166C6C

The Hexadecimal Color #166C6C is a contrast shade of Teal. #166C6C RGB value is rgb(22, 108, 108). RGB Color Model of #166C6C consists of 8% red, 42% green and 42% blue. HSL color Mode of #166C6C has 180°(degrees) Hue, 66% Saturation and 25% Lightness. #166C6C color has an wavelength of 506.66667n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#166C6C is #339999.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#166C6C is #166. The Closest Color to #166C6C is #008080. Official Name of #166C6C Hex Code is Genoa.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#166C6C is 80 Cyan 0 Magenta 0 Yellow 58 Black and #166C6C CMY is 80, 0,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#166C6C is hsl(180,66,25,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(180, 80, 42).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#166C6C is 8.4, 11.98, 16.05.
Hex8 Value of #166C6C is #166C6CFF. Decimal Value of #166C6C is 1469548 and Octal Value of #166C6C is 5466154. Binary Value of #166C6C is 10110, 1101100, 1101100 and Android of #166C6C is 4279659628 / 0xff166c6c.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#166C6C is 0.231, 0.329, 0.329 and YIQ Color Space of #166C6C is 82.286, -51.2474, -18.189.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#166C6C is 8.7, 14.52, 15.97.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#166C6C is 41.18, -23.77, -7.06.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#166C6C is 41.18, -29.78, -6.41.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#166C6C is 41.18, 24.8, 196.54. Hunter Lab variable of #166C6C is 34.61, -17.25, -3.26.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#166C6C

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
